GSITX vs. AVALX
GSITX (Goldman Sachs Small Cap Value Insights Fund) and AVALX (Aegis Value Fund) are both Small Cap Value Equities funds. Over the past 10 years, GSITX returned 13.24%/yr vs 20.56%/yr for AVALX. A 0.70 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. GSITX charges 0.84%/yr vs 1.50%/yr for AVALX.

Drawdowns
GSITX vs. AVALX -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um GSITX drawdown since its inception was -56.37%, smaller than the maximum AVALX drawdown of -73.72%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for GSITX and AVALX.
